Warning signs in applicant submissions, such as unexplained employment gaps, frequent job changes, inconsistencies in stated qualifications, and the omission of vital information, can indicate potential problems for prospective employers. For example, a resume listing different job titles for the same role at a single company may suggest an attempt to embellish experience.

Careful evaluation of these indicators helps organizations make informed hiring decisions, potentially saving time and resources in the long run. The appropriate quantity of professional background information presented on a curriculum vitae depends on several factors, including career level, industry norms, and the specific requirements of the target position. For entry-level roles, highlighting internships, volunteer work, and relevant academic projects can effectively demonstrate skills and potential. Experienced professionals, however, should prioritize showcasing accomplishments and quantifiable results from previous roles, focusing on the most recent and relevant experiences. An example of effective presentation for a seasoned professional could include a concise summary of 10-15 years of experience, emphasizing key achievements and skills aligned with the target role. Less relevant or older positions might be summarized more briefly or omitted altogether.

A well-tailored presentation of professional history is critical for making a strong impression on potential employers. By strategically selecting and highlighting pertinent experiences, candidates can effectively communicate their qualifications and suitability for a specific role. This targeted approach allows recruiters to quickly assess the candidate’s value proposition and determine if their background aligns with the organization’s needs. Historically, resumes served as a comprehensive chronological record of an individual’s work history. Modern best practices, however, emphasize a more strategic and concise approach, focusing on demonstrating value and relevance over exhaustive documentation.
